Following the new album by C-C-B, which reunited last year after making a splash on the CX series "SMAP x SMAP" and as the theme song for boxer Daisuke Naito's entrance, Makoto Sekiguchi's new solo song, his first in three and a half years, has finally arrived! The lead track "Blue Sky" is a cheering song for all the men in the world who keep working and dreaming of a sunny tomorrow! And "Eternal Blooming Flower" is also a great song! Both of these songs are nostalgic and new type of "songs" for the R-35 generation and older. Romantic music never stops! Profile of Makoto SekiguchiMakoto Sekiguchi made his debut as a guitarist of C-C-B in June 1983. In 1985, he released the single "Romantic Never Stops" and gained explosive popularity, but two years later, despite the peak of his popularity, he became independent from the band. During the first year after independence, he worked as a radio personality, published short stories, and engaged in a wide range of other activities. In 1988, he made his solo debut in order to resume his musical activities, and is currently active in live performances mainly at live houses, as well as appearing on television. In addition to his activities up to the previous year, he also gave concerts in parallel. In 1991, he released "Tengawa Densetsu Murder Case," which became a hit (the theme song for the movie of the same title, which was later released by Akina Nakamori as "Futari Shizuka," and became an even bigger hit). ), Sekiguchi's name became popular again. He is currently active as a writer and music producer, providing songs to numerous artists.
